Translation by booth at Mahatun Plaza Building

Featured Replies

Last weeks I am busy asking offers for translation and legalisation by E-mail. At Mahatun Plaza are a lot of booth and got only one offer of 4 offices. One offer of 11500 Baht for 3 pages total. When I asked again by another office I get unclear answers of the same E-mail address as the first. I traced 3 offices with the same lady. First- the offer of 11,500 Baht is very high I believe. Is there no competition or is it scam. I would not send my orriginal passport copy and mariage certificate to this kind of office.

 

Some advise please

6 minutes ago, Marius Brok said:

Normal need 7 working day they say. Do not like to stay one week in Bangkok in my holydays.

Ask them to send the translated and certified documents by EMS to you. They will do that for a small additional fee.
